千家论坛_弱电智能化技术与工程讨论(建筑智能,家居智能,人工智能)

项目信息与经验分享
收藏本版 |订阅

项目信息与经验分享 今日: 4443 |主题: 26287|排名: 9 

发新帖
打印 上一主题 下一主题

电脑控制家电 串口控制继电器 电脑控制继电器 串口I...

[复制链接]
manure242 发布于: 2010-4-23 10:04 1424 次浏览 0 位用户参与讨论
跳转到指定楼层
  电脑控制家电 串口控制继电器 电脑控制继电器 串口IO模块(三进三出)说明






输入电压:DC 12V.板载稳压芯片.
通信协议:异步串行通信协议(RS232),八位数据,一位停止位.无奇偶校验位.波特率9600bps.

数据格式:帧传送,超时溢出,带数据回传.
数据以帧的形式发送,每帧9字节,如果中途丢失数据,或发现数据校验和错误,那该帧数据将无效,并且不会有数据回传.如果帧数据正确并成功执行命令,控制板就会回发本帧数据.上层软件可以利用回发来确定控制板是否正确接收并执行命令,如果50ms内没有接收到回传数据,说明和控制板的通信错误,这时应该重发帧数据.以保证控制板执行命令.
工业现场情况复杂,通信距离长等,都会产生严重的干扰,常出现数据丢失或数据错误等现象.本控制板带校验和,正确执行时回传数据,数据超时溢出功能,在严重干扰时能保证数据可靠传输,命令正确执行.

帧 格 式:9字节,如下.
1        2        3        4        5       6         7             8        9
00H    5AH    53H    地址    命令    数据    返回状态    保留    校验和

第1字节固定是:00H
第2字节固定是:5AH
第3字节固定是:53H
第4字节是:地址字节.由板上跳线决定,当总线上挂了两块控制板以上时,数据发给哪个控制板,就由这地址位决定.
 
A2            A1            A0            地址
0(短路)    0(短路)    0(短路)    00H
0(短路)    0(短路)    1(开路)    01H
0(短路)    1(开路)    0(短路)    02H
0(短路)    1(开路)    1(开路)    03H
1(开路)    0(短路)    0(短路)    04H
1(开路)    0(短路)    1(开路)    05H
1(开路)    1(开路)    0(短路)    06H
1(开路)    1(开路)    1(开路)    07H

第5字节是:命令字节.控制继电器的断开与闭合.
第6字节是:数据字节
第7字节是:返回的状态,位5至位0有效

Bit5            Bit4            Bit3             Bit2               Bit1               Bit0
Y2闭合为1    Y1闭合为1    Y0闭合为1    X2高电平为1    X1高电平为1    X0高电平为1
Y2断开为0    Y1断开为0    Y0断开为0    X2低电平为0    X1低电平为0    X0低电平为0

命令(第5字节)    数据(第6字节)                                                                        返回状态第7字节
位开命令  0x01    第n个继电器闭合,如:n=2表示第二个继电器闭合                            Y2-Y0,X2-X0的状态
位关命令  0x02    第n个继电器断开,如:n=4表示第四个继电器断开                            Y2-Y0,X2-X0的状态
全开命令  0x03    所有继电器闭合,本字节可以为任意数据                                        Y2-Y0,X2-X0的状态
全关命令  0x04    所有继电器断开,本字节可以为任意数据                                        Y2-Y0,X2-X0的状态
组开命令  0x05    几个继电器一齐闭合,如n=00011000表示第四,五个继电器一齐闭合    Y2-Y0,X2-X0的状态
组关命令  0x06    几个继电器一齐断开,如n=00000101表示第一,三个继电器一齐断开    Y2-Y0,X2-X0的状态
读状态命令0x07    无效,可以为任意字节                                                              Y2-Y0,X2-X0的状态

第8字节固定是:00H。保留字节。日后扩展用
第9字节是:校验和

控制板在大电流处铺锡布线,能保证大电流可靠地通过
优质的接线端子,使线头更容易锁紧,大电流更容易通过,不易掉线.

基本输入输出:
 
基本输入:X2-X0:
电压    2V至24V            为逻辑1
电压    -24V至0.8V        为逻辑0

基本输出:Y2-Y0
Y2至Y0为继电器开关量常开输出。相当于一个开关。最大电流220V/10A


提供VB源代码,方便用户更改,自定自己的软件
 


 
TEL:13632846183   张工
E-MAIL:jx_0009@yahoo.com.cn
WEB:www.lgmcu.com
Taobao: http://shop33686141.taobao.com/


[此贴子已经被作者于2010-4-23 10:08:00编辑过]

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?立即注册 新浪微博登陆 千家通行证登陆

x
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册 新浪微博登陆 千家通行证登陆

本版积分规则

千家智客微信号
千家智客微信
玩物说商城
玩物说商城